MCP Catalogs
首页

mcp-search

by caikiji·1·综合分 37

基于 SearXNG 的 MCP 服务器,提供隐私保护的元搜索功能。

searchai-llmdeveloper-tools
0
Forks
0
活跃 Issue
本月
最近提交
2 天前
收录于

概述

@caikiji/mcp-search 是一个通过 SearXNG 实例提供网络搜索功能的 MCP 服务器。它提供了网页查询、去重、片段提取和页面抓取等工具。该服务器设计为隐私保护,支持自托管选项,并包含令牌高效的紧凑模式和可自定义的搜索参数。它支持多个搜索引擎,并通过环境变量提供详细的配置选项。

试试问 AI

装完之后,这里有 5 个你可以让 AI 做的事:

:将隐私保护的网页搜索集成到 AI 助手中
:用于学术研究和内容创作的工具
:自动化内容收集和分析
:如何设置我自己的 SearXNG 实例?
:支持哪些搜索引擎?

什么时候选它

当您需要尊重隐私的网络搜索,控制自己的数据访问权限,并且希望通过一个界面访问多个搜索引擎时,选择这个 MCP 服务器。

什么时候不要选它

如果您需要来自谷歌或必应等商业引擎的实时搜索结果,或者需要 SearXNG 提供之外的功能,请不要选择这个服务器。

此 server 暴露的工具

从 README 抽取出 3 个工具
  • queryquery(query, [language], [categories], [time_range], [engines], [pageno], [count], [format])

    Web search with deduplication, snippet, and source info

  • resultresult(url, [max_length])

    Fetch a URL and return as Markdown

  • infoinfo([scope])

    Show instance information and available search engines

可对比工具

mcp-duckduckgomcp-brave-searchperplexity-mcpweb-search-server

安装

npm install -g @caikiji/mcp-search

添加到 Claude Desktop 配置:

{
  "mcpServers": {
    "search": {
      "command": "npx",
      "args": ["-y", "@caikiji/mcp-search"],
      "env": {
        "SEARCH_URL": "https://search.example.com",
        "SEARCH_AUTH": "user:password"
      }
    }
  }
}

FAQ

如何设置我自己的 SearXNG 实例?
您可以使用 Docker 部署 SearXNG,或按照 https://searxng.github.io/searxng/admin/installation.html 上的安装指南进行操作
支持哪些搜索引擎?
该服务器支持 Brave、DuckDuckGo、Bing News 等引擎,具体取决于您的 SearXNG 实例配置。使用 'info' 工具查看可用引擎。

mcp-search 对比

GitHub →

最后更新于 · 由 README + GitHub 公开数据自动生成。